The S157 CO2 Analyzer is a single channel non-dispersive infrared CO2 analyzer that measures CO2 in 0 to 2000 ppm range with 1 ppm resolution. This CO2 Analyzer is ideal for CO2 exchange measurements with leaves, insects, small animals or organisms with a low metabolic rate. It is also excellent for measuring soil respiratory activity in the lab and field. The analyzer may be used in a flow-through gas exchange configuration for instantaneous and continuous measurements of CO2 exchange. It can also be used in stop flow or closed system modes for measurements at extremely low activity levels. The S157 CO2 Analyzer shares the same infrared technology and modular design as the S158 CO2 Analyzer. The S157 CO2 Analyzer may also be used as part of Qubit Systems’ carbon dioxide control system for regulating pCO2 in growth cabinet. We recommend using S157 with our C950 Gas Exchange Software or other data acquisitions software.

Specifications:
Operating principle: Non-dispersive infrared
Gas sampling mode: Flowing gas stream, sealed chamber
Maximum gas flow rate: 650 mL/min
Measurement range (LCD display): 0 – 1999 ppm
Analog output, low sensitivity: 0 – 2000 ppm
Analog output, high sensitivity: 0 – 500 ppm
Accuracy: Better than ± 2% of full scale
Repeatability: Better than ±1% of reading
Maximum drift: (per year) ±100 ppm
Response time : (@ 250 mL/min; to 95% of final value) ca. 45 sec Warm up time (@ 22oC) ca. 5 min
Output (linear) for Low Sensitivity setting: 0 – 5 VDC for 0 – 2000 ppm
Output (linear) for High Sensitivity setting: 0 – 5 VDC for 0 – 500 ppm
Calibration adjustments : Zero and Span
Operating temperature range: 0 to 50oC
Storage temperature range: -40 to 70oC
Operating pressure range: ±1.5% local mean pressure
Humidity range: 5 to 95% RH, non-condensing (recommend drying gas stream)
Pressure dependence: +0.19% reading per mm Hg
Power requirements: 12 VDC via 120 VAC/60 Hz adapter
Current requirements: 175 mA average, 450 mA peak
Dimensions: (cm) (H x W x D: 25.4 x 10.2 x 15.2)
Weight: 2.2 kg
Warranty: 1 year limited
